Fratelli Paradiso: Italian Brunch in Potts Point
In Potts Point, Fratelli Paradiso is a favorite spot. This café mixes Italian style with Australian brunch in a fun setting. The art-filled decor adds to the lively feel.
Their poached eggs on sourdough bread with house-made pestos are a popular choice. Coffee fans also love their strong coffee, so it’s a must-visit place.
Theaugust: Hip Spot with Creative Dishes
Theaugust is another top spot in Potts Point. It’s known for its cool vibe and creative twists on classic dishes. Their corn fritters with avocado and lime are super tasty, with a nice crunch and flavor.
The casual, stylish look makes it a great place to relax and enjoy brunch. It’s easy to get to by public transport, so locals and tourists both enjoy it.
Single O: Fresh Flavors and Specialty Coffee in Surry Hills
In Surry Hills, Single O is a favorite brunch choice. It’s famous for its great coffee and fresh, seasonal foods.
The café is lively, matching the area’s fun vibe. A favorite here is the breakfast burrito with eggs, beans, and local produce. It’s a tasty way to start the day.
Poly: Unique Dishes in a Cozy Space
Poly in Surry Hills is known for its changing menu and focus on quality. They have items like poached eggs and fresh salads that are always well-made. The cozy setting makes it a great place to relax and enjoy brunch. Since the menu changes, you can try something new every time.

Three Blue Ducks
When you explore Bondi Beach, you will find some great places to eat. One popular spot is Three Blue Ducks. This restaurant has a menu filled with fresh ingredients from local farms.
Here, you can try their famous avocado toast, which comes with herbs and lemon, or their delicious garden salad. This place emphasizes quality food and feels like a community gathering spot. It is a favorite for locals and visitors alike.
Bondi Hardware
Another great choice is Bondi Hardware. This lively brunch place offers a variety of tasty dishes. One of their highlights features ricotta pancakes topped with seasonal fruits and drizzled with pure maple syrup.
The warm and rustic decor creates a friendly atmosphere. Friends and families can enjoy time together, making brunch even better.
Beach Road Hotel
Lastly, you shouldn’t miss the Beach Road Hotel. It has a cozy feel and a brunch menu with many delicious coastal flavors. You can enjoy homemade granola bowls or hearty breakfast options while taking in the lively vibe of Bondi Beach. By mixing great food with beautiful views, this place shows why brunch at Bondi is a must-do for anyone visiting Sydney.
Grounds of Alexandria: A Brunch Experience Like No Other
Located in the heart of Alexandria, Grounds of Alexandria is one of the best places for brunch in Sydney. This special place combines a lively dining area with lovely garden features. It creates a fun experience for locals and tourists alike.
When you step into Grounds, you are surrounded by lovely plants, fragrant herbs, blooming flowers, and rustic decorations. This lovely setting is a great place to enjoy a meal. Here, the experience is just as important as the food.
Fresh, Local Ingredients
Grounds of Alexandria is proud to use fresh, sustainable, and locally sourced ingredients. They follow a farm-to-table philosophy, which means they get their food straight from the farm to your table. The menu is full of creative dishes that appeal to different tastes.
For example, the famous ‘Grounds Breakfast’ includes organic eggs, artisan sourdough toast, and house-made baked beans. They also offer tasty vegan and gluten-free options. Seasonal specials let guests enjoy new flavors, making each visit exciting.
Coffee and Bakery Delights
Besides the delicious brunch, Grounds of Alexandria has great coffee stations and a bakery on-site. Visitors can enjoy freshly baked pastries and artisanal bread while they eat.
